Hiking in Wukounigwald, a forested area within the Völkermarkt district of Austria, offers diverse natural features for outdoor activities. The region is characterized by its dense forests and proximity to the Karawanken Mountains, providing varied elevations and panoramic views. Hikers can expect vistas of the Jauntal valley and access to nearby idyllic swimming lakes such as Klopeiner See and Turnersee, as well as the Völkermarkt reservoir. This landscape provides a mix of mountainous terrain, lush woodlands, and serene waterscapes.

The Diex parish church is one of the best preserved fortified churches in Carinthia and is located in the center of Diex on the southern slope of the Saualpe. It is dedicated to Saint Martin. The church was first mentioned in a Gurk land register in 1326, but its origins date back to before 1168.

The Zingerle Kreuz (1,891 m) is located on the Saualpe and is very easy to reach. From the Wolfsberger Hütte car park, it takes about 30 minutes if you take a leisurely hike. I slept at the Wolfsberger Hütte and hiked up to see the sunset and sunrise. Fantastically beautiful and highly recommended!

Since 2023, the old Diex warehouse has housed a small museum and a self-service shop with regional products (eggs, potatoes, pasta, flour, oils, bacon, soaps, creams, ...). Open all day.

Wukounigwald offers a wide range of hiking opportunities, with over 180 trails recorded on komoot. These routes cater to various preferences, from leisurely walks to more challenging mountain excursions.
The region is generally best for hiking from spring through autumn. During these seasons, you can enjoy the lush forests and meadows, as well as the scenic views of the Jauntal valley and the Karawanken mountains. While specific winter conditions vary, some trails might be suitable for snowshoeing, but it's always advisable to check local conditions.
Hikers in Wukounigwald can expect a diverse landscape. Trails often traverse dense forests and open meadows, with many routes offering mountainous backdrops from the nearby Karawanken range. You'll find a mix of varied elevations and serene waterscapes, including views of the Jauntal valley and proximity to lakes like Klopeiner See.
